Are you allowed to enter a pet in the beauty contest on a side-account? I don't want to risk it and end up frozen!
Also, can you enter a picture of a pet that's a painted color, but the real pet only be a basic color? I'd like to enter my kougra, OhanzeeHakan who is currently just a red kougra, but I'm entering a picture of him as a fire kougra. Would that be breaking some strange, unheard of rule?
Thanks! :D

You're allowed to enter pets on side-accounts. Well, at least I've done it before without any problem. :) As long as you don't vote for that pet with more than one of your accounts.

And you can enter your kougra as any color you want. There's no rule against it. As long as it's the same species, you're fine.

Actually, sometimes you can't. My old guild leader (teddybleedstears) entered a grey ixi picture but it was rejected because she haddn't painted it grey yet. On the last day for entering she painted it and got it through.

(then she won first place... then soon frozen :()

But I have seen cases when the colour isn't the same. Maybe there was a different judge who got her picture.
